首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法计算django中的PostgeSQL请求

Django是一个开源的高级Web应用框架,使用Python语言编写,旨在简化和快速开发复杂的Web应用程序。它提供了一系列强大的工具和功能,包括数据库访问、表单处理、URL路由、模板引擎等,使开发人员能够专注于业务逻辑的实现。

在Django中,与PostgreSQL的请求计算无法进行的情况可能是由于以下几个原因:

  1. 配置问题:确保你已经正确配置了Django项目中的PostgreSQL数据库连接信息。在项目的设置文件(settings.py)中,需要设置DATABASES字典中的'ENGINE'、'NAME'、'USER'、'PASSWORD'等参数,以便Django能够正确连接和操作PostgreSQL数据库。
  2. 数据库访问问题:确认你的代码中是否存在错误的数据库访问方式或语法错误。比如,尝试访问不存在的数据库表、使用错误的SQL语句等都可能导致请求无法计算。
  3. 数据库连接问题:如果你的PostgreSQL数据库出现连接问题,比如网络不可达、连接数超过限制等,都可能导致请求无法计算。确保你的数据库服务正常运行,并且Django应用程序能够正确连接到数据库。
  4. 数据库性能问题:如果你的数据库中存储了大量数据,或者执行的查询操作涉及复杂的逻辑,那么请求计算可能需要较长的时间。在这种情况下,你可以优化数据库的索引、调整查询语句、增加数据库服务器的硬件资源等来提升性能。

对于Django中无法计算PostgreSQL请求的问题,可以通过以下步骤进行排查和解决:

  1. 检查Django项目的数据库配置是否正确,包括数据库连接参数、数据库名称等。
  2. 确认数据库服务是否正常运行,检查网络连接是否正常。
  3. 检查代码中的数据库访问方式和语法,确保没有错误。
  4. 如果涉及大量数据或复杂查询,考虑对数据库进行性能优化。

腾讯云提供了一系列与云计算相关的产品和服务,可以帮助您构建和管理Django应用程序所需的基础设施和环境。以下是几个推荐的腾讯云产品和对应的链接地址:

  1. 云服务器(CVM):提供了灵活可扩展的虚拟服务器实例,可以用于部署Django应用程序。详情请参考:https://cloud.tencent.com/product/cvm
  2. 云数据库PostgreSQL版:提供了高性能、可扩展的托管式PostgreSQL数据库服务,可以满足Django应用程序的数据库需求。详情请参考:https://cloud.tencent.com/product/postgres
  3. 云联网(CCN):提供了一种用于组建和管理多个VPC之间互联的网络产品,可以帮助您搭建跨地域的网络环境,以支持Django应用程序的跨地域访问。详情请参考:https://cloud.tencent.com/product/ccn

以上是我对于无法计算django中的PostgreSQL请求的问题的一些解答和建议,希望能对您有所帮助。如有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券